Well this problems is solved. As someone pointed out, Jack both times, |
10 |
it was related to things not being set. To expose the Logitech drivers |
11 |
you need INPUT, HID and LEDS_CLASS all set. If you don't then Logitech |
12 |
will disappear. |
13 |
|
14 |
I'm sure that in the past I've had to enable things and when I tried to |
15 |
select them, I couldn't and then a look in the help indicated something |
16 |
else needed to be enabled - enable it and I could subsequent select. In |
17 |
this case, the thing, LOGITECH was not even displayed. As to whether |
18 |
this is new behaviour or not, can't select Vs hidden, I don't know. |
